How to reduce welding fume

During the welding process, welding fumes will inevitably be generated, and these welding fumes will seriously endanger the health of operators and also pollute the atmospheric environment. The metal dust generated by welding is easily inhaled into the lungs, causing lesions. Under the action of welding arc and strong ultraviolet rays, an irritating poisonous gas will be produced. Long-term inhalation will cause occupational diseases such as bronchitis and emphysema. Similarly, these soot and dust are discharged without treatment, which is also a pollution to the atmosphere. very serious!

So, how to eliminate the harm caused by welding fumes? The editor shares four directions with you. These measures can basically solve the problem of welding fume control in most factories.


1. Update and improve welding processes and materials, so as to reduce welding fumes

The hazards caused by electric welding are mostly related to the composition of the electrode coating. By improving the electrode material and selecting clean, embroidered and oil-free welding materials, the generation and emission of harmful gases can be better reduced. In addition, welding should be made. The operation is transformed to mechanization and automation, and the application of welding robots can not only reduce the labor intensity of workers and improve productivity, but also protect the health of workers.

2. Welding fumes are collected directly at the welding point

Use the suction arm of the Welding Fume Purifier to absorb the welding fume at the source, and then discharge it after purification by the welding fume purifier, which can better control the welding fume. soot.

3. Separate the welding area for centralized purification

If it is difficult to collect welding fume at the point where the welding fume is generated, the welding fume generated on the production line can be centrally treated by isolating the welding area. The more common situation is that the factory sets up a fixed closed welding room, or adopts mobile Type semi-closed fume exhaust hood, and then use the welding fume purifier to purify. In this way, the fume and dust generated by multiple welding stations can be collected and purified, and the emission of fume and dust can be better avoided to pollute other areas of the workshop.

4. Comprehensively collect workshop dust and carry out unified purification treatment

If it is a large workshop where large workpieces are welded with complex and changeable working conditions, it is more suitable to use this treatment method. The commonly used equipment in this method is a central welding fume purifier, such as large parts and special-shaped parts in the workshop, which need to be driven. The hoisted workpiece is welded and dedusted, so this processing method is more convenient and efficient.
